Dental Awareness Assists In How To Cure Bad Breath

August 19th, 2008

Bad breath can be caused by a number of reasons, and the best way to
know how to cure bad breath is to understand these causes. Gum disease
is a dental condition that is also characterized by bad breath. The
best options for a bad breath relief caused by gum disease is to seek
professional dental help. Majority of the bad breath cases, though, are
caused by bacteria thriving in the mouth. These bacteria live in the
back of your tongue and along the other soft tissues of your inner
mouth. Poor oral hygiene practices can cause these bad bacteria to
accumulate and lead to bad breath and gum disease. It is essentially
important to eliminate these bacteria to stop the development of bad
breath. While a routine oral hygiene can help in balancing dental
health, seeking a dentist is the best way to cure and prevent bad breath
caused by gum disease and other teeth and gum problems. Be aware of
your dental health and know more about how to cure bad breath and other
oral risks for effective prevention.

Understand Halitosis Bad Breath Worries!

May 29th, 2008

Halitosis, or bad breath
as it is commonly known, begins as a simple nuisance: morning breath.
We all have at least a mild case of morning breath—just not always in
the a.m. depending on your sleep schedule. Anaerobic bacteria are
responsible for nearly 90% of all problems with bad breath or
halitosis. Sometimes, however, medical problems like upper respiratory
infections can also cause halitosis and bad breath. Even the medicine
we take for colds and other respiratory disorders can create a bad
breath problem because antihistamines are designed to cause dehydration
in the sinuses—and thus causing dry mouth. In most cases, anaerobic
bacteria are the cause and saliva is the cure for halitosis and bad
breath.

How To Get Rid Of Bad Breath The Healthy Way

May 29th, 2008

It really is a lot easier than you think to know how to get rid of bad breath.
You don’t necessarily need to go out and buy a bunch of fancy mouth
wash products or other over-the-counter bad breath cures if you
understand what causes the problem in the first place: oral bacteria.
Human saliva can help to naturally prevent halitosis because it has a
high oxygen concentration and will therefore slow the reproduction of
the harmful bacteria. By simply staying away from known sources of
dehydration and making sure to practice good oral hygiene (brushing and
flossing daily and being sure to cleanse the back of the tongue where
gram-negative bacteria like to congregate), you can avoid bad breath
problems in the future.
